Summer Finn is often misunderstood. A generation of men initially labeled her a "manic pixie dream girl" or a villain. However, repeated viewings reveal the truth: Summer is brutally honest from the beginning. She tells Tom she does not want a serious relationship. Tom, blinded by his projection of destiny, refuses to hear her. This makes the film a painful, beautiful exploration of self-deception. 500 days of summer katmoviehd

begins with a clear warning: "This is not a love story." Despite this, many viewers find themselves rooting for the protagonist, Tom Hansen, and viewing Summer Finn as the "villain" for not reciprocating his feelings. However, a closer look at the film’s non-linear structure reveals that the true conflict isn't between two people, but between a man and his own unrealistic expectations of love. Released in 2009, Marc Webb’s (500) Days of Summer completely disrupted the traditional Hollywood romantic comedy. Starring Joseph Gordon-Levitt as Tom Hansen and Zooey Deschanel as Summer Finn, the film bypassed standard genre tropes to offer a non-linear, cautionary tale about expectation versus reality in relationships. Over a decade later, the film remains a massive cultural touchstone.
